Skip to Content

P0102 OBD-II Mass or Volume Air Flow A Circuit Low Trouble Code

The P0102 code is an OBD-II trouble code that stands for “Mass or Volume Air Flow A Circuit Low” and is triggered when the engine control module (ECM) or powertrain control module (PCM) identifies a problem with the performance of the mass airflow (MAF) sensor.

In this article, I will be talking about the P0102 trouble code, its symptoms, causes, and how to fix it.

What Does The P0102 Code Mean?

The P0102 trouble code means that the powertrain control module (PCM) of the vehicle has concluded that the incoming signal from the mass air flow sensor is below the lower threshold of its working range. As a result, the PCM has consequently judged that these data are illogical.

To comprehend the importance of code P0102, one must first comprehend what a mass airflow (MAF) sensor is and how it functions. A mass air flow sensor measures the volume of air passing through the intake tract of an engine at any given time.

This information is relayed in real-time to a vehicle’s PCM, which utilizes it to compute the correct amount of fuel to give in order to maximize combustion.

Without reasonable input from the engine’s mass air flow sensor, the PCM cannot precisely and optimally measure fuel supply.

When a vehicle stores a P0102 trouble code, the PCM has concluded that the mass air flow sensor’s incoming data is invalid and below the unit’s normal voltage threshold.

Which Models Are Affected By The P0102 Code

Make Affected By P0102 Code
Toyota Yes
Nissan Yes
Chevrolet Yes
BMW Yes
Audi Yes
Buick Yes
Mercedes Yes
GMC Yes
Suzuki Yes
Tata Yes
Lexus Yes
Mazda Yes
Mitsubishi Yes
Kia Yes
Jeep Yes
Fiat Yes
Honda Yes
Hyundai Yes
Opel Yes
Ford Yes
Fiat Yes
Peugeot Yes

What Are The Possible Causes of the P0102 Code?

An active P0102 code may be caused by a variety of underlying issues. The most prevalent of them are listed below.

  • Clean the dirty mass airflow (MAF) sensor.
  • Replace the faulty or damaged MAF sensor.
  • Repairing the low voltage, electrical short, or wiring harness.
  • Replace the dirty air filter.
  • Clean the MAF sensor connectors.
  • Repair the leaks from the vacuum.
  • Change the faulty PCM or ECM.

This Article Contains:

How To Fix The P0102 Code

Here is how to fix the P0102 trouble code:

  • Check the code using a scanner. Reset the trouble codes and perform a road test under regular driving conditions.
  • If the P0102 code returns, it is essential to execute the test method.
  • Check the electrical connector to the MAF to ensure that it is properly installed. To ensure a new electrical connection and eliminate any corrosion on the contacts, detach and reinstall the component.
  • Examine the connector carefully for frayed, damaged, or broken wiring. Restore or replace as required.
  • Especially on older vehicles, inspect the intake manifold hose and fittings for vacuum leaks.
READ ALSO  P2020 code – Intake Manifold Runner Position Sensor/Switch Circuit Low (Bank 2) – Causes, Symptoms and How To Fix

In Conclusion

As I said before the P0102 trouble code usually pops up when there is some issue with the mass airflow (MAF) sensor.

If you have an OBD-II scanner and can confirm the P0102 code, you should take your car to a mechanic so the professional can determine the source of the problem. Occasionally, the issue can be rectified by verifying the codes, clearing them, and restarting the car.

If the code is a one-time anomaly (which is possible), you can proceed. Still, got a problem code? Bring it to a mechanic. You can troubleshoot the cause(s) yourself, but due to their knowledge and experience, an expert can address the issue much more quickly.

  1. Use a scan tool to check if you have another active trouble code like misfire codes or 02 sensor codes.
  2. Eliminate all trouble codes from the system.
  3. Take the car for a test drive and observe what trouble codes are generated.
  4. Read the updated codes to obtain freeze frame information.
  5. Measure the MAF sensor’s voltage and ground. Examine the MAF sensor wiring to determine whether anything is visibly damaged. Repair the wiring if the ECU outputs a low voltage or bad ground.
  6. If you observe any dirt or corrosion on the MAF sensor head, you can carefully remove it with a MAF cleaner.
  7. Check for air leaks throughout the system.
  8. Examine the air filter. If it is unclean, it should be replaced.
  9. Using real-time data, check for vacuum leaks.
  10. If no additional issues have been identified, proceed to replace the MAF sensor.

Most Common Mistakes When Diagnosing The P0102 Code

The most common mistake is replacing the MAF sensor without first verifying if it is the source of the problem. While the code indicates a problem with the MAF sensor, the sensor may be reading incorrectly due to other causes.

It is also possible that the MAF sensor requires a simple cleaning. If it is dirty or corroded, a simple cleaning should be sufficient.

To clean the MAF sensor, remove it and clean the sensor head with an electrical cleaner or a MAF sensor-specific cleaner before allowing it to dry. This element is extremely delicate and easily damaged, so handle it with care and avoid touching it!

How Much Does It Cost To Repair P0102 Code?

If you intend to have the parts replaced by a shop, you will need to pay for both the parts and the work. These are some estimations for the cost of the repairs.

  • Cleaning the dirty mass airflow (MAF) sensor: $10-$75
  • MAF sensor replacement: $250-$400
  • Repairing the electrical short or wiring harness: $50-$500
  • Repairing the intake air leak: $100-$650
  • Air filter replacement: $15-$85
READ ALSO  P0404 code – Exhaust Gas Recirculation Circuit Range/Performance - Causes, Symptoms and How To Fix
Make P0102 Code Repair Cost
Toyota Yes $10 – $650
Nissan Yes $10 – $650
Chevrolet Yes $10 – $650
BMW Yes $10 – $650
Audi Yes $10 – $650
Buick Yes $10 – $650
Mercedes Yes $10 – $650
GMC Yes $10 – $650
Suzuki Yes $10 – $650
Tata Yes $10 – $650
Lexus Yes $10 – $650
Mazda Yes $10 – $650
Mitsubishi Yes $10 – $650
Kia Yes $10 – $650
Jeep Yes $10 – $650
Fiat Yes $10 – $650
Honda Yes $10 – $650
Hyundai Yes $10 – $650
Opel Yes $10 – $650
Ford Yes $10 – $650
Fiat Yes $10 – $650
Peugeot Yes $10 – $650

What Repairs Can Fix The P0102 Code?

The most frequent repairs that can fix the P0102 trouble code are:

  • Clean the dirty mass airflow (MAF) sensor.
  • Replace the faulty or damaged MAF sensor.
  • Repairing the low voltage, electrical short, or wiring harness.
  • Replace the dirty air filter.
  • Clean the MAF sensor connectors.
  • Repair the leaks from the vacuum.
  • Change the faulty PCM or ECM.

How To Fix The P0102 Code

Here is how to fix the P0102 trouble code:

  • Check the code using a scanner. Reset the trouble codes and perform a road test under regular driving conditions.
  • If the P0102 code returns, it is essential to execute the test method.
  • Check the electrical connector to the MAF to ensure that it is properly installed. To ensure a new electrical connection and eliminate any corrosion on the contacts, detach and reinstall the component.
  • Examine the connector carefully for frayed, damaged, or broken wiring. Restore or replace as required.
  • Especially on older vehicles, inspect the intake manifold hose and fittings for vacuum leaks.

In Conclusion

As I said before the P0102 trouble code usually pops up when there is some issue with the mass airflow (MAF) sensor.

If you have an OBD-II scanner and can confirm the P0102 code, you should take your car to a mechanic so the professional can determine the source of the problem. Occasionally, the issue can be rectified by verifying the codes, clearing them, and restarting the car.

If the code is a one-time anomaly (which is possible), you can proceed. Still, got a problem code? Bring it to a mechanic. You can troubleshoot the cause(s) yourself, but due to their knowledge and experience, an expert can address the issue much more quickly.

  • Faulty or damaged Mass Air Flow (MAF) sensor.
  • Dirty air filter.
  • The Mass Air Flow (MAF) sensor circuit wiring or connectors are corroded or damaged.
  • Carbon-covered MAF sensor displays.
  • The leaks from the vacuum.
  • Faulty PCM or ECM.
READ ALSO  P205C code – Reductant Tank Level Sensor Circuit Low – Causes, Symptoms and How To Fix

What Are The Common Symptoms of The P0102 Code?

In many instances, additional symptoms will manifest in conjunction with a P0102 diagnostic issue code. Although these extra symptoms are not present in every case, they are common enough to demand the attention of drivers.

These are the most frequent symptoms linked with code P0102.

Is It Safe To Drive With a P0102 Code?

Technically, you may still be able to drive with a P0102 code, but you should not do so for too long.

Although code P0102 is not suggestive of serious problems, it is urged that any underlying cause be repaired without delay. When your vehicle has a problem with the MAF sensor, fuel economy might be negatively impacted, resulting in higher costs at the pump.

Also, some motorists may face a variety of drivability concerns when their car displays a P0102 error code.

This problem has been known to cause engine stalling and difficult starting, resulting in unreliable vehicle performance. It is often advisable to handle such concerns before the symptoms worsen and leave you stranded.

How To Diagnose The P0102 Code

Here is how to diagnose the P0102 trouble code:

  1. Use a scan tool to check if you have another active trouble code like misfire codes or 02 sensor codes.
  2. Eliminate all trouble codes from the system.
  3. Take the car for a test drive and observe what trouble codes are generated.
  4. Read the updated codes to obtain freeze frame information.
  5. Measure the MAF sensor’s voltage and ground. Examine the MAF sensor wiring to determine whether anything is visibly damaged. Repair the wiring if the ECU outputs a low voltage or bad ground.
  6. If you observe any dirt or corrosion on the MAF sensor head, you can carefully remove it with a MAF cleaner.
  7. Check for air leaks throughout the system.
  8. Examine the air filter. If it is unclean, it should be replaced.
  9. Using real-time data, check for vacuum leaks.
  10. If no additional issues have been identified, proceed to replace the MAF sensor.

Most Common Mistakes When Diagnosing The P0102 Code

The most common mistake is replacing the MAF sensor without first verifying if it is the source of the problem. While the code indicates a problem with the MAF sensor, the sensor may be reading incorrectly due to other causes.

It is also possible that the MAF sensor requires a simple cleaning. If it is dirty or corroded, a simple cleaning should be sufficient.

To clean the MAF sensor, remove it and clean the sensor head with an electrical cleaner or a MAF sensor-specific cleaner before allowing it to dry. This element is extremely delicate and easily damaged, so handle it with care and avoid touching it!

How Much Does It Cost To Repair P0102 Code?

If you intend to have the parts replaced by a shop, you will need to pay for both the parts and the work. These are some estimations for the cost of the repairs.

  • Cleaning the dirty mass airflow (MAF) sensor: $10-$75
  • MAF sensor replacement: $250-$400
  • Repairing the electrical short or wiring harness: $50-$500
  • Repairing the intake air leak: $100-$650
  • Air filter replacement: $15-$85
Make P0102 Code Repair Cost
Toyota Yes $10 – $650
Nissan Yes $10 – $650
Chevrolet Yes $10 – $650
BMW Yes $10 – $650
Audi Yes $10 – $650
Buick Yes $10 – $650
Mercedes Yes $10 – $650
GMC Yes $10 – $650
Suzuki Yes $10 – $650
Tata Yes $10 – $650
Lexus Yes $10 – $650
Mazda Yes $10 – $650
Mitsubishi Yes $10 – $650
Kia Yes $10 – $650
Jeep Yes $10 – $650
Fiat Yes $10 – $650
Honda Yes $10 – $650
Hyundai Yes $10 – $650
Opel Yes $10 – $650
Ford Yes $10 – $650
Fiat Yes $10 – $650
Peugeot Yes $10 – $650

What Repairs Can Fix The P0102 Code?

The most frequent repairs that can fix the P0102 trouble code are:

  • Clean the dirty mass airflow (MAF) sensor.
  • Replace the faulty or damaged MAF sensor.
  • Repairing the low voltage, electrical short, or wiring harness.
  • Replace the dirty air filter.
  • Clean the MAF sensor connectors.
  • Repair the leaks from the vacuum.
  • Change the faulty PCM or ECM.

How To Fix The P0102 Code

Here is how to fix the P0102 trouble code:

  • Check the code using a scanner. Reset the trouble codes and perform a road test under regular driving conditions.
  • If the P0102 code returns, it is essential to execute the test method.
  • Check the electrical connector to the MAF to ensure that it is properly installed. To ensure a new electrical connection and eliminate any corrosion on the contacts, detach and reinstall the component.
  • Examine the connector carefully for frayed, damaged, or broken wiring. Restore or replace as required.
  • Especially on older vehicles, inspect the intake manifold hose and fittings for vacuum leaks.

In Conclusion

As I said before the P0102 trouble code usually pops up when there is some issue with the mass airflow (MAF) sensor.

If you have an OBD-II scanner and can confirm the P0102 code, you should take your car to a mechanic so the professional can determine the source of the problem. Occasionally, the issue can be rectified by verifying the codes, clearing them, and restarting the car.

If the code is a one-time anomaly (which is possible), you can proceed. Still, got a problem code? Bring it to a mechanic. You can troubleshoot the cause(s) yourself, but due to their knowledge and experience, an expert can address the issue much more quickly.